Chapter 1
What Is a Platform, and How Much Money Will It Make You?
If you are reading these words, your primary question about this book is likely to be, “What’s in it for me?” That’s exactly what your customers are asking also, before they invest their time or money in your product or service. It’s a fair question and every purveyor should be grateful when someone stops to browse their wares.
So thank you. Thanks for trusting me this far and for giving this page a chance to let you know how keenly this book is designed to help you achieve your goals as a businessperson.
To sell you on reading these words, I have to guess why you picked it up in the first place. It’s my job to determine what you hope to get from this and then to deliver it, so you will be a satisfied customer.
Here goes.
For us entrepreneurs, “growth” means “more sales.” One way to get more sales is to get more new customers. More customers result from more people knowing about you, your product or your service. The way you get more people to know about you is by building your platform. “Platform” is a jargon word for a large, growing group of fans who love you, your product, or your service. Your platform is the crowd of people who want to buy your stuff.
When a famous person like Justin Bieber or Kim Kardashian sends a tweet about a product, service, or other artist they like, it usually goes viral. That’s because all stars by definition have platforms.
You probably don’t want to be chased by paparazzi or be on the cover of People magazine, but what could happen for you in your niche if everyone knew your business’ name—or yours? How much more money will you make when lots of people realize you are the best purveyor of whatever you’re selling? A sustainable, well-built platform will attract prospects to you with minimal effort. Your profits will increase at the same velocity as your platform grows.

WHO ARE THESE PEOPLE?
Just for the record, I use the word “customers” to refer to clients, patients, constituents, or listeners when referring to people who give you money or who take the action you want them to take. I use the word “money” to refer to whatever benefit it is that you desire from building your platform.
